內皮細胞培養基 ECM  的詳細介紹
內皮細胞培養基是專門為正常人類微血管內皮細胞體外培養設計的*適于其生長的完全培養基。是經滅菌的液體培養基,包含必需和非必需氨基酸、維生素、有機和無機化合物、激素、生長因子、微量礦物質和低濃度胎牛血清(5%)。該培養基緩沖體系為重碳酸鹽,在含5%CO2的細胞培養箱中平衡后pH值為7.4。該培養基的配方能夠選擇性的促進正常人類微血管內皮細胞體外培養中的增殖和生長,并為其達到*理想營養平衡狀態提供數量上和質量上的保證。
內皮細胞培養基包含500 ml基礎培養基,25ml胎牛血清(FBS,目錄編號0025),5ml內皮細胞生長添加物(ECGS,目錄編號1052),和5 ml青霉素/鏈霉素溶液(P/S,目錄編號0503)
